Setting Up Your Worm Composting Bin
Begin by selecting a suitable bin. A plastic or wooden container with a lid works well. Ensure it has drainage holes and is at least 12 inches deep. Place your bin in a dark, cool location to keep your worms comfortable.
Choosing the Right Worms
Red wigglers (Eisenia fetida) are the best choice for composting. You can purchase them from local bait shops or online suppliers. Aim for about 1 pound of worms for every 2 pounds of food waste.
Feeding Your Composting Worms
Feed your worms a balanced diet of:
- Fruit and vegetable scraps
- Coffee grounds
- Shredded paper and cardboard
Avoid citrus, meat, and dairy products, as these can attract pests and create odors.
Maintaining Your Worm Bin
Keep the bedding moist but not soggy. Check your bin regularly for odors or pests. If you notice any issues, adjust moisture levels and remove any uneaten food.
Common Mistakes to Avoid
Many beginners overfeed their worms or neglect to maintain proper moisture levels. Always monitor your bin and make adjustments as necessary to ensure a thriving ecosystem.

Hot Composting Techniques: Speed Up Your Decomposition Process
If you’re looking to accelerate your composting efforts, mastering hot composting techniques is essential. This method uses heat generated by microbial activity to speed up the decomposition process, transforming organic waste into rich compost in as little as 2-8 weeks. Here’s how to do it effectively.
Step-by-Step Guidance for Hot Composting
- Choose the Right Location: Select a well-drained area that receives sunlight to maintain high temperatures.
- Build Your Pile: Create a compost pile that is at least 3 feet by 3 feet. This size allows for efficient heat retention.
- Balance Green and Brown Materials: Aim for a carbon to nitrogen ratio of 30:1. Use green materials (e.g., kitchen scraps, grass clippings) and brown materials (e.g., dried leaves, cardboard) in equal parts.
- Maintain Moisture Levels: Your compost should be as damp as a wrung-out sponge. Add water as needed, but avoid oversaturation.
- Turn Your Pile: Every 5-7 days, aerate your compost by turning it. This process introduces oxygen, which is crucial for maintaining high temperatures.
Expert Tips for Successful Hot Composting
- Monitor the temperature: Ideal composting temperatures range from 130°F to 160°F. Use a compost thermometer to check.
- Avoid adding diseased plants or meat products, which can attract pests and create odor problems.
- Chop or shred larger materials to enhance decomposition speed.
Common Mistakes to Avoid
Many gardeners overlook the importance of balance in their compost piles. Too much nitrogen can lead to odors, while too much carbon slows the process. Additionally, neglecting to turn the pile can result in anaerobic conditions, stalling decomposition.

The Benefits of Bokashi Composting: Fermenting Kitchen Waste for Beginners
Bokashi composting is an innovative method that offers numerous benefits for gardeners looking to recycle kitchen waste effectively. This fermentation process is not only quick but also enriches the soil with essential nutrients, making it a must-try for eco-conscious gardeners.
Why Choose Bokashi Composting?
- Speed: Unlike traditional composting, Bokashi composting takes mere weeks to break down organic material.
- Odor Control: The anaerobic fermentation process minimizes unpleasant smells, making it ideal for indoor use.
- Versatility: Almost all kitchen scraps can be composted, including meat and dairy, which are typically not recommended for standard composting.
Step-by-Step Guide to Bokashi Composting
- Gather Your Supplies: You’ll need a Bokashi bin, Bokashi bran (inoculated with beneficial microbes), and kitchen waste.
- Layering: Alternate layers of kitchen scraps and Bokashi bran in your bin, ensuring each layer is packed down.
- Seal It Up: Close the bin tightly to create an anaerobic environment for fermentation.
- Fermentation Time: Allow the mixture to ferment for 2-3 weeks, then bury it in your garden or add it to your compost pile.
Expert Gardening Tips
To maximize the benefits of Bokashi composting, consider these expert tips:
- Monitor moisture levels—your mixture should be damp but not soggy.
- Avoid adding excessive citrus or spicy foods, as they can disrupt the fermentation process.
- Regularly check for signs of fermentation; a sweet, sour smell indicates success.
Avoid Common Mistakes
New gardeners often make a few common mistakes:
- Overpacking the bin can hinder airflow and fermentation.
- Neglecting to add enough Bokashi bran can slow down the process.

Layering for Success: Mastering the Carbon-Nitrogen Ratio in Composting
Composting is an art that hinges on understanding the carbon-nitrogen (C:N) ratio. To create nutrient-rich compost, a balanced mix of “browns” (carbon-rich materials) and “greens” (nitrogen-rich materials) is essential. Aim for a C:N ratio of approximately 30:1 for optimal decomposition.
Understanding Carbon and Nitrogen Sources
To achieve this ideal balance, consider the following materials:
- Carbon Sources (Browns): Dry leaves, straw, wood chips, and cardboard.
- Nitrogen Sources (Greens): Grass clippings, kitchen scraps (vegetable peels, coffee grounds), and manure.
Step-by-Step Guidance
- Gather Materials: Collect a variety of browns and greens. For every 3 parts of browns, add 1 part of greens.
- Layering Technique: Alternate layers of browns and greens in your compost bin.
- Aerate Regularly: Turn your compost every few weeks to introduce oxygen, promoting faster decomposition.
Expert Tips and Common Mistakes
To ensure your compost thrives:
- Keep your compost moist, but not soggy. A damp sponge consistency is ideal.
- Avoid adding meat, dairy, and oils, which can attract pests.
- Monitor the temperature; a hot compost (140°F to 160°F) breaks down materials quickly.

How can I troubleshoot my compost bin if it smells?
If your compost bin smells, it may be due to excess moisture or an imbalance of greens and browns. To fix this, add dry carbon materials like straw or shredded paper and ensure proper aeration by turning the compost regularly. This will help eliminate odors and promote a healthier composting environment.
